We may be closing in on the discovery of alien life. Are we prepared? – NBC News

Science News

  1. We may be closing in on the discovery of alien life. Are we prepared?  NBC News
  2. NASA’s InSight mission is struggling to dig into Mars  CNN
  3. Are we ready for aliens? NASA’s chief scientist has given his answer  Inverse
  4. NASA’s Stuck Mars ‘Mole’ Gets a Helping Hand from Arm Scoop  Space.com
  5. View full coverage on Google News

Source: Science News